Allequippa Terrace was one tough place. Once a state-of-the-art public housing development, it eventually fell on hard times along with most other communities of its type. A high concentration of poverty-level residents now seems so obviously wrongheaded that we have forgotten that "the projects" represented progressive thought when they were built.
